The Relationship between knowledge, Attitude and Acceptance of Human Papilloma Virus (HPV) Vaccination for Cervical Cancer Prevention among Students at Bushehr University of Medical Sciences, Iran

Background: Human Papilloma Virus (HPV) is the causative agent of cervical cancer. Vaccination against HPV is an effective strategy against cervical cancer. This study aimed to assess the acceptance of HPV vaccination for cervical cancer prevention and its relationship with knowledge and attitude about HPV vaccination among students. Methods: This cross-sectional study was carried out on ۳۶۰ female students at Bushehr University of Medical Sciences in ۲۰۱۸. Students were recruited using proportional stratified random sampling method. Data was gathered using a questionnaire about knowledge, attitude and effective factors of HPV vaccine acceptance. Descriptive analysis, chi-square, independent sample t-test, and logistic regression were used to analyze the data in SPSS-۱۶.۰ (SPSS Inc., Chicago, IL, USA).  The significance level was set at P < ۰.۰۵. Results: ۵۶.۴% of students had poor knowledge while ۵۴.۱% were willing to accept HPV vaccination as well as ۴۳% who had positive attitude towards HPV vaccination. Paramedical students were ۹۶% more likely to accept the HPV vaccination compared to health sciences faculty students (OR= ۱.۹۶; ۹۵% CI= ۱.۰۴-۳.۶۸; p=۰.۰۳۶).  Also, for each unit increase in the HPV knowledge score, students were ۱۵% more likely to accept the vaccine (OR= ۱.۱۵; ۹۵% CI= ۱.۰۷-۱.۲۴; p <۰.۰۰۱). Moreover, for each unit increase in attitude score, students were ۱۶% more likely willing to accept HPV vaccine (OR= ۱.۱۶; ۹۵% CI=۱.۰۸ -۱.۲۸; p =۰.۰۰۲). Conclusions: It is necessary to implement on HPV vaccination for students. Inclusion of HPV vaccine in the National Program on Immunization would also be an effective strategy for improving HPV vaccination.
